BlackRock Drives $1.7 Billion Bitcoin ETF Inflows Amid Geopolitical Uncertainty

In a notable demonstration of institutional commitment, Bitcoin ETFs have seen a substantial influx of $1.7 billion over six days, with BlackRock spearheading this momentum. This influx occurred between May 29 and June 16, 2025, pushing total assets under management in Bitcoin ETFs to an impressive $132.5 billion. The investment surge comes despite heightened geopolitical tensions in the Middle East, highlighting Bitcoin’s emerging status as a resilient store of value and a hedge against global instability. BlackRock’s leadership, including a peak daily inflow of $412 million, exemplifies the growing confidence among asset managers in Bitcoin’s long-term viability.

Institutional Interest Strengthens Bitcoin’s Market Architecture

Institutional investors, including Metaplanet alongside BlackRock, have significantly contributed to the ETF inflows, reinforcing Bitcoin’s market infrastructure. This trend reflects a strategic shift where institutional portfolios increasingly incorporate Bitcoin to diversify risk and capitalize on its non-correlated asset characteristics. Despite the geopolitical unrest, Bitcoin’s price stability suggests that institutional demand is effectively buffering the market against volatility. This resilience is further evidenced by steady corporate treasury accumulations and muted fluctuations in related crypto assets such as Ethereum, indicating a broader institutional endorsement of digital assets.
